This registry is for Dodge trucks from 1972-1980. I currently have over 350 trucks in my database. I also include the 1970-1971 Dude package trucks, 1981 W150 and Ramcharger Macho package trucks as well as the 1987/1990 Rod Hall package trucks.
Of course, the staple trucks are invited too. That being the Lil Red Express, Warlocks, Machos, Palominos, Big Horns and True Spirits.


I take any and all information on any truck from this era. So if you have a 1975 regular cab Custom D100 slant 6 w/no options shoot me what ya got.
This is what I would need:
VIN number
outside color
interior color
transmission
front and/or rear axle size
gear ratio
any extra cost options(Adv SE, tach, tuff wheel, paint procedure, wheels etc...)

If the truck still has the underhood equiptment label, i would like those codes.

If the truck still has the radiator support tag (commonly known to car guys as fender tag) the info off those.
